Noun edit

melancholian (plural melancholians)

  1. (obsolete) A person affected with melancholy; a melancholic.
    • 1697-1698, John Scott, Practical Discourses upon Several Subjects
      And hence you may observe in the Modern Stories of our Religious Melancholians, that they commonly pass out of one Passion into another without any manner of Reasoning and Discourse
